WebPrimary Commands in EDIT or Browse or View mode: Primary commands are those that can be executed from the command line and are valid on any or all the lines of the dataset. General rules for entering primary commands are: Either a blank or a comma can be used a separator between command operands. The command input field contains trailing nulls. WebJan 25, 2024 · Select the text you want to copy (in the ".txt" file) Press CTRL-C Open the mainframe file using ISPF Edit (option 2). Enter line command "Inn" at the line where where you want the copy to start. (This inserts "nn" empty lines to receive the copied data.
